Сайт бесплатного дистанционного обучения для кафедры КТ

 Сайт бесплатного дистанционного обучения для кафедры КТ

Содержание
Введение..................................................................................................................... 14
1 Аналитическая часть.............................................................................................. 15
1.1 Современные технологии разработки сайтов ............................................. 15
1.1.1 Особенности современных Wеb-редакторов ...................................... 16
1.1.2 Классификация интернет-систем ......................................................... 17
1.2 Последовательности создания сайта бесплатного дистанционного
обучения ..................................................................................................................... 20
1.2.1 Постановка задачи ................................................................................. 20
1.2.2 Назначение и область применение сайта ............................................ 21
1.2.3 Анализ предметной области ................................................................. 22
1.2.4 Модели и технологии дистанционного обучения ............................. 25
1.2.5 Дистанционное обучение с использованием сети Интернет............ 31
1.2.6 Дистанционное обучения в Казахстане .............................................. 33
2 Программы используемые при разработке программы ..................................... 41
2.1 История создания РНР.................................................................................... 41
2.2 Преимущества PHP ........................................................................................ 43
2.3 Возможности PHP ........................................................................................... 45
2.4 Язык гипертекстовой разметки HTML ......................................................... 47
2.5 CSS – каскадные таблицы стилей.................................................................. 48
2.6 Объектно-ориентированный язык jаvascript ............................................... 49
2.7 Основы XML.................................................................................................... 50
2.8 Система управления базами данных MySQL............................................... 52
3 Создание базы данных и приложения к ней........................................................ 57
3.1 СУБД ............................................................................................................... 57
3.2 Разграничение доступа ................................................................................... 58
3.3 Создание базы данных на Wampserver ......................................................... 62
3.4 Описание программы...................................................................................... 64
4 Технико-экономическое обоснование ................................................................. 71
4.1 Описание работы и обоснование необходимости ....................................... 71
4.2 Оборудование и программное обеспечение используемое в работе ........ 71
4.3.Определение объема и трудоемкости разработки программного
обеспечения................................................................................................................ 72
4.4 Расчет затрат на разработку информационных технологий....................... 74
4.5 Расчет цены программного продукта .......................................................... 79
Вывод.......................................................................................................................... 79
5 Безопасность жизнедеятельности......................................................................... 81
5.1 Анализ условий труда..................................................................................... 81
5.2 Рабочее место программиста ........................................................................ 85
5.3 Расчёт естественного освещения................................................................... 86
5.4 Расчёт искусственного освещения методом коэффициента использования
..................................................................................................................................... 88
5.5 Средства пожаротушения............................................................................... 90
Вывод.......................................................................................................................... 91
Список литературы ................................................................................................... 93
Приложение А ........................................................................................................... 94
Приложение Б .......................................................................................................... 142
Приложение В.......................................................................................................... 144
Приложение Г .......................................................................................................... 145
Приложение Д.......................................................................................................... 145
Приложение Ж......................................................................................................... 145
Приложение З .......................................................................................................... 146

1.1 Современные технологии разработки сайтов

Создание сайтов – это далеко не такой легкий процесс, каким он может
показаться на первый взгляд непрофессионалу. Создать эффективный сайт,
который будет привлекать внимание пользователей в сети, при этом
удовлетворяя самым высоким требованиями различных поисковых систем, по
силам не каждому разработчику. Необходимо постоянно совершенствовать
свои знания, овладевая новыми технологиями создания сайтов. Современные
технологии создания сайтов позволяют создавать веб -ресурсы, которые быстро
оправдывают вложенные в их разработку средства, предоставляя владельцу
широкие возможности для использования сайта как инструмента
маркетинговой политики, а также средства распространения необходимой
информации. Но данный созданный сайт, не влечет за собой финансовую
прибыль, а улучшения и модернизация процесса образования.
Безусловно, владеть различными технологиями создания веб -сайтов
может только специалист, для которого создание сайтов – это каждодневный
труд. Какие же технологии создания сайта необходимо в совершенстве изучить,
чтобы получать результаты, которые будут удовлетворять всем требованиям
заказчика:
PHP-скрипт, являющийся одним из самых популярных среди технологий создания веб - сайтов;сайтов;
Java Script, который постоянно совершенствуется в процессе создания
HTML, необходимый для создания страниц текста, которые зате
будут легко читаться в любом браузере;
СУБД и MySQL, предназначенные для работы со структурированными базами данных;
CSS – оформления внешнего вида веб - страниц, написанных с помощью
языков разметки HTML и XHTML, но может также применяться к любым
XML- документам, например, к SVG или XUL.
Каждый разработчик использует те технологии создания сайтов, которые
считает наиболее подходящими для себя. Однако грамотный специалист
выбирает технологию в соответствии с задачами, которые перед ним возникают
в процессе разработки, и которые он должен максимально эффективно решить.
Технологии создания сайтов не стоят на месте, каждый день появляются
новинки, которые можно использовать в процессе работы. Создание сайтов –
творческий процесс, а для реализации всех своих идей необходимо владеть
современной технологической базой, совершенствовать свои умения и
получать новые знания в области веб - технологий.

1.1.1 Особенности современных Wеb-редакторов

Редактор источников кода дает не имеющие ограничений возможности
контроля над HTML-тэгами и их форматированием. Для того чтобы
переключиться из режима разметки страницы в режим редактирования кода,
можно просто щелкнуть по специальной вкладке в окне документа. Внеся
изменения в код, вы можете тут же просмотреть их, щелкнув по другой
вкладке.
Контроль синтаксиса, поддержка HTML и функций jаvascript мало
отличаются на различных платформах. Вот почему нынешние Wеb-дизайнеры
располагают встроенной функцией проверки синтаксиса. Она разрешает узнать,
какие браузеры, и на каких платформах поддерживают все те элементы,
которые вы предусмотрели на своей странице, будь то DHTML или таблицы
стилей. Вы можете построить страницу в HTML 4.0, преобразовать ее в
стандартный формат HTML 3.2 или произвести ее в обоих вариантах, дав право
выбора пользователю.
Динамические компоненты и шаблоны. Если на Wеb-сайте имеются такие
общие элементы дизайна, как навигационные панели и заголовки, которые
наличествуют на каждой странице, то вам особенно приглянутся динамические
компоненты, разрешающие употреблять некоторые элементы страниц,
сделанные раньше и уже снабженные текстами, картинками или другим
содержимым. Проще говоря, можно организовывать шаблонные страницы и
употреблять их снова и снова для сотворения сложных сайтов.
Встроенный FTP-клиент. Нынешние Wеb-сайты оснащены глубоким
интегрированным FTP-клиентом, который разрешает загружать и обновлять
Wеb-сайт. Когда появляется нужда обновить сайт, запускается процесс
обновления, будут обновлены только помеченные файлы. Можно так же
переносить отдельные страницы, просто "перенося" их с панели FTP или,
напротив, на нее. Для удобства работы нынешние Wеb-дизайнеры
высчитывают время, которое потребуется посетителям сайта для загрузки
ваших страниц.
HTML-редактор – это программа, с помощью которой создаются HTML-
документы, то есть те самые WEB-страницы. В настоящее время существуют
редакторы двух типов: WYSIWYG-редакторы и редакторы тегов. К этому
можно добавить, что большинство современных текстовых редакторов умеют
сохранять документы в формате HTML. WYSIWYG-редакторы – это
программы, с помощью которых можно создавать страницы, не имея никакого
понятия о языке HTML. Самым распространенным из них является, вероятно,
Microsoft FrontPage. При работе с этого редактора не видно самого процесса
строительства страницы. Это все равно, как строить дом, собирая его из
готовых, уже покрашенных и помытых кем-то стен, крыши и т.д. Удобно,
конечно, быстро, но никогда не можешь быть уверенным, что дом будет
теплым, крепким, надежным. И вторая причина, более важная, но, тем не менее,
вытекающая из первой: у меня нет достаточного опыта работы с такими
редакторами. Если кто-то предпочтет работать с Microsoft FrontPage, например,
я думаю, он найдет как минимум несколько учебников в интернете, плюс
учебник в самой программе. К тому же ему можно пропустить те главы на этом
сайте, в которых будет рассказываться о создании страницы с помощью
редактора тегов и значит у него появится время для освоения Microsoft
FrontPage.
Недостатком WYSIWYG-редакторов является громоздкость созданных с
их помощью HTML-документов. Это получается оттого, что WYSIWYG-
редакторы вставляют HTML-коды, как говорится, "на все случаи жизни". В
результате объем документа, а значит и время загрузки страницы,
увеличивается. Ведь серверу даже для того, чтобы рассказать браузеру о
пустом месте, то есть пробеле, необходимо передать информацию, а значит
затратить какое-то время. Второй вид HTML-редактороров – редакторы тегов.
При работе с ними Вы видите непосредственно HTML-код документа, можете
оперативно изменять его, контролируя результат – просматривая создаваемую
страницу браузером. В этом случае, как правило, документ получается более
компактным и изящным (здесь говорится именно о HTML-документе, а не о
странице, которая будет видна в окне браузера. Красота и изящность страницы
очень слабо связаны со способом ее создания).

1.1.2 Классификация интернет-систем

Цель любой информационной системы – обработка данных об объектах
реального мира.
Интернет продукты можно классифицировать по ниже следующим
пунктам.
По правам на доступность сервисов:
 Открытые – все сервисы полностью доступны для любых посетителей
и пользователей.
 Полуоткрытые – для доступа необходимо зарегистрироваться (обычно
бесплатно).
 Закрытые – полностью закрытые служебные сайты организаций (в том
числе корпоративные сайты), личные сайты частных лиц. Такие сайты
доступны для узкого круга пользователей. Доступ новым пользователям
обычно даётся через приглашения (инвайты).
По физическому расположению:
 Общедоступные сайты сети Интернет.
 Локальные сайты – доступны только в пределах локальной сети.
Информационные ресурсы:
 Тематический сайт –сайт, предоставляющий специфическую
узкоспециализированную информацию по какой-либо теме.
 Тематический портал – это большой веб-ресурс,
который предоставляет исчерпывающую информацию по определённой тематике.
Порталы похожи на тематические сайты, но дополнительно содержат средства
взаимодействия с пользователями и позволяют пользователям общаться в
рамках портала (форумы, чаты) – это среда существования пользователя.
Интернет-представительства владельцев бизнеса (торговля и услуги, не
всегда связанные напрямую с Интернетом):
 Сайт-визитка – содержит самые общие данные о владельце сайта
(организация или индивидуальный предприниматель). Вид деятельности,
история, прайс-лист, контактные данные,реквизиты, схема проезда.
Специалисты размещают своё резюме, то есть подробная визитная карточка.
 Представительский сайт – так иногда называют сайт-визитку с
расширенной функциональностью: подробное описание услуг, портфолио,

отзывы, форма обратной связи и т.д.
 Корпоративный сайт –содержит полную информацию о
компании/владельце, услугах/продукции, событиях в жизни компании.
Отличается от сайта - визитки и представительского сайта полнотой
представленной информации, зачастую содержит различные функциональные
инструменты для работы с содержимым (поиск и фильтры, календари событий,
фотогалереи, блоги, форумы). Может быть интегрирован с внутренними
информационными системами компании - владельца (КИС, CRM,
бухгалтерскими системами). Может содержать закрытые разделы для тех или
иных групп пользователей – сотрудников, дилеров, контрагентов и пр.
 Каталог продукции – в каталоге присутствует подробное описание
товаров/услуг, сертификаты, технические и потребительские данные, отзывы
экспертов и т.д. На таких сайтах размещается информация о товарах/услугах,
которую невозможно поместить в прайс-лист.
 Интернет-магазин – сайт с каталогом продукции, с помощью которого
клиент может заказать нужные ему товары. Используются различные системы
расчётов: от пересылки товаров наложенным платежом или автоматической
пересылки счета по факсу до расчётов с помощью пластиковых карт.
 Промо-сайт – сайт о конкретной торговой марке или продукте, на таких
сайтах размещается исчерпывающая информация о бренде, различных
рекламных акциях (конкурсы, викторины, игры и т.п.).
 Сайт-квест – Интернет-ресурс, на котором организовано соревнование
по разгадыванию последовательности взаимосвязанных логических загадок.
Веб-сервис – сайт, созданный для выполнения каких либо задач либо
предоставления услуг в рамках глобальной сети:
 Доска объявлений.
 Каталог сайтов – например,OpenDirectoryProject.
 Поисковые сервисы – например,Yahoo!,Google.
 Почтовый сервис.
 Форумы.
 Блоговый сервис.
 Файл обменный Пиринговый сервис – например, Bittorrent.
 Датахостинговый (хранение данных) сервиc – например,Skydrive.
 Датаэдиторинговый (редактирование данных) сервиc – например,
GoogleDocs.
 Фотохостинг – например, Picnik, ImageShack, Panoramio, Photobucket.
 Хранение видео – например, YouTube, Dailymotion.
 Социальные Медиа – например, Buzz.
 Комбинированные веб-сервисы (Социальные сети) – например,
Facebook, Twitter, ВКонтакте.
 Комбинированные веб-сервисы (Специализированные социальные
сети) - например, MySpace, Flickr, SpringMe.
Немного подробнее о досках объявлений. Доска объявлений – сайт
предоставляющий площадку для размещения объявления. Это может быть сайт
с конкретной узконаправленной тематикой, многопрофильный, платным или
бесплатным, отдельным сайтом некоторого конкретного города либо региона,
может быть модерируемый либо администрируемый и т.д.
По технологии отображения:
 Статические
–состоящие из статичных html (htm) страниц
составляющих единое целое. Пользователю выдаются файлы в том виде, в
котором они хранятся на сервере.
 Динамические – состоящие из динамичных html (htm, dhtml) страниц-
шаблонов, информации, скриптов и прочего в виде отдельных файлов.
Содержимое генерируется по запросу специальными скриптами (программами)
на основе других данных из любого источника.
По типам макетов:
 Фиксированной ширин
(англ.rigidfixed
–размеры элементов
страницы имеют фиксированное значение, независящее от разрешения,
размера, соотношения сторон экрана монитора и размеров окна обозревателя,
задаётся в абсолютных значениях— PX (пиксели).
 Резиновый макет (англ.adaptablefluid) – размеры несущих элементов,
значения ширины, задаются относительным значением – % (проценты),
страницы отображаются во весь экран монитора по ширине . По сути данный
тип макета является частным случаем фиксированного типа макета.
Динамично эластичный (англ.dynamically expandable elastic) – размеры
большинства элементов, задаются относительными значениями – EM и % . Все
относительные пропорции размеров элементов всегда остаются неизменными,
независимо от разрешения, размера, соотношения сторон экрана монитора,
размеров окна и масштаба окна обозревателя, и всегда постоянны относительно
окна обозревателя.
1.2 Последовательности создания сайта бесплатного дистанционного
обучения

1.2.1 Постановка задачи
При постановки задачи необходимо решить следующие вопросы:
 целевая аудитория, на которую рассчитывается создание данного
проекта;
 основные цели и задачи проекта.
Также при создании сайта на этапе построения задачи решается вопрос
создания структуры сайта. Под структурой сайта подразумевается составление
разделов сайта. Под структурой сайта понимается навигационная структура, и
она обычно изображена в виде пунктов меню. К постановке задачи также
относится разработка функциональности сайта и требования к дизайну.
Функциональность сайта значимый элемент, от которого зависит,
приглянется ли посетителю система управления сайтом. Если Вы сделаете
слишком тяжелую систему управления, тем меньшее количество посетителей
захочет возвратиться на ваш сайт. В такой ситуации действует правило:
«Будьте проще и люди к Вам потянуться».
Что относится к дизайну сайта, то здесь не существует каких-либо
строгих правил. Дизайн сайта во многом зависит от целевого назначения сайта.
Например, корпоративный сайт может отражать фирменный стиль корпорации.
Таким образом, дизайн корпоративного сайта будет осуществлен в
корпоративных цветах корпорации. Возьмем, простой пример. Банк имеет
логотип, исполненный из нескольких элементов красного и желтого цвета. Т.е.
будет логичным применять в дизайне сайта именно эти цвета. Кроме того,
дизайнеры не советуют использовать в дизайне сайта более 2-3 тонов. Практика
представляет, что во многом успех отдельных сайтов абсолютно не зависит от
их дизайна. Здесь примитивным примером может быть поисковая система
Яндекс, которая пользуется большой известностью, несмотря на достаточно
простой дизайн
Конечно,самым важным на этапе постановки задачи является определение стратегических целей.
Создание сайта может быть организовано на всевозможных масштабах
бюджета, но независимо от этого, сайт создается для того, чтобы о нем узнали.
Это значит что, при постановке задачи разработчики решают важные вопросы
определения ключевых слов, назначенных для продвижения сайта в поисковых
системах, установление перспективных рекламных площадок и т.д. Уже на
этапе постановки задачи, сайтов владелец может примерно знать, чего ждать от
реализации данного проекта......


Толық нұсқасын 30 секундтан кейін жүктей аласыз!!!


Әлеуметтік желілерде бөлісіңіз:
Facebook | VK | WhatsApp | Telegram | Twitter

Қарап көріңіз 👇



Пайдалы сілтемелер:
» Ораза кестесі 2024 жыл. Астана, Алматы, Шымкент т.б. ауыз бекіту және ауызашар уақыты
» Туған күнге 99 тілектер жинағы: өз сөзімен, қысқаша, қарапайым туған күнге тілек
» Абай Құнанбаев барлық өлеңдер жинағын жүктеу, оқу

Соңғы жаңалықтар:
» Биыл 1 сыныпқа өтініш қабылдау 1 сәуірде басталып, 2024 жылғы 31 тамызға дейін жалғасады.
» Жұмыссыз жастарға 1 миллион теңгеге дейінгі ҚАЙТЫМСЫЗ гранттар. Өтінім қабылдау басталды!
» 2024 жылы студенттердің стипендиясы қанша теңгеге өседі